Understanding RAM's Role in Gaming Random Access Memory serves as the short-term data storage your CPU relies on to access game assets quickly. If your usage is confined to gaming on medium settings with a few background programs, 16GB provides ample headroom.

16GB RAM in the Current Landscape For the majority of gamers, 16GB remains a competent baseline that handles modern titles effectively. While 16GB has long been the standard recommendation for most players, the rapid advancement of game engines and background applications has pushed 32GB into the mainstream conversation.

This decision impacts not only current performance but also the longevity of your system as titles continue to demand more resources. When 32GB Becomes Necessary Upgrading to 32GB is strategic for specific user profiles who engage in content creation alongside gaming.

However, in scenarios involving ultra-high-resolution textures or open-world games with extensive draw distances, 32GB allows the system to load assets seamlessly without paging data to the storage drive, which results in consistent visual quality. Additionally, certain platforms impose restrictions; for example, some laptops or pre-built systems allocate half of the 32GB to the integrated graphics, effectively reducing the available amount for the dedicated GPU if the system relies on shared memory architecture.
